Alert Management Specialist

2 weeks ago


Calgary, Alberta, Canada Blackline Safety Full time $45,000 - $65,000 per year

Our team at Blackline Safety is growing As a people-driven technology company, with a mission to make sure every worker returns home safely, we drive innovation, practice resiliency, demonstrate leadership, go the extra mile for our customers, and empower our people to be their best.

We are currently hiring an Alert Management Specialist to join our growing Safety Operations Center based in Calgary, Alberta. The Alert Management Specialist reports to Reporting to the Manager, Safety Operations Center. This role provides a professional and timely service for our customers. Our Alert Management Specialists manage safety incidents efficiently and conscientiously from onset through to resolution. This is a part-time position.

Requirements:

  • Fluent written & spoken English is required
  • Consistently demonstrate a strong work ethic to handle a high volume of client interactions with diligence, professionalism, and attention to detail.
  • Ability to demonstrate proficiency utilizing technology to maintain organized records, access information, and manage client accounts or inquiries, ensuring data accuracy and security.
  • Demonstrate the ability to work autonomously and efficiently, taking initiative to complete tasks and projects with minimal supervision.
  • Demonstrates the ability to identify and correct errors or inconsistencies in data, documents, and processes. Pays careful attention to the finer points and ensures thoroughness in every aspect of work, resulting in quality outcomes and minimal margin for error
  • Demonstrated ability to proficiently handle concurrent tasks and adeptly oversee projects with flexible timelines.
  • Demonstrate the capacity to adjust and accommodate variations in work hours or schedules as needed to meet organizational demands.
  • Apply critical thinking and problem-solving skills to address challenges, make quick decisions when required, and implement solutions that align with organizational goals.
  • Minimum five years of customer service experience
  • Previous experience in a customer service or dispatch role is required
  • Valid First Aid and CPR

Responsibilities:

  • Monitor the safety of our customers' personnel
  • Manage emergency alerts and follow escalation protocols professionally, with efficiency
  • Respond to emergency situations with calm and confidence
  • Provide basic troubleshooting and technical support when an alert is triggered
  • Monitor weather and road conditions where customers are working alone to keep them informed of potential issues
  • Provide excellent customer service 
  • Maintain records and prepare reports

About Blackline Safety

Blackline Safety is a world leader in the development and manufacturing of wirelessly connected safety products. We offer the broadest and most complete portfolio available in the industry. Our products are designed to save lives and we monitor personnel working alone in populated areas, complex indoor facilities, and the remote reaches of our planet. Blackline's products are used to keep people safe in the event of falls, missed check-ins, man-downs, and exposure to explosive or toxic gas. Our design, development, sales, marketing, support, and production are all performed in-house at our headquarters in Calgary, AB. Blackline Safety is a publicly-traded company (TSX: BLN).
